Support: 10.174 (Lower BB); Resistance: 13.881 (21-EMA)
Technical Analysis: Bias Bearish
BTG/USD in the red for the 7th straight week, trades 0.51% lower at 11.136 at 08:30 GMT.
The pair holds support at $11, 'Death Cross' (bearish 50-DMA crossover on 200-DMA) keeps scope for further downside.
Price action has hit 6-month lows (unseen since Feb 2019), momentum strongly bearish.
Major and minor trend are bearish as shown by the GMMA indicator. MACD and ADX support weakness.
Oscillators are at oversold territory, however, no signs of reversal seen on charts as of now.
'Death Cross' (bearish 50-DMA crossover on 200-DMA) on the daily charts keeps scope for further downside.
Immediate support below 11.0 handle lies at 88.6% Fib at 10.886. Break below will see weakness till 8.10 (Jan 28 low).
